We'll be at OKW Saturday!:cool1:

I have two boys who usually sleep together in the pull out in the living room, but my youngest tends to have accidents....which will make it kind of hard to have them sleep together. Can I request a roll away or something?

Thanks all!
Jenny:)
 
most DVCers bring their own air mattress, which is what i would suggest.

some of the DVCs attached to hotels (like VWL/WL) might be able to sneak one of the hotel's cots but OKW won't have anything. timeshares are just different...
 
I agree with chalee94 - I doubt very seriously if you'll get a roll away or a cot. Check Walmart or Target for an inexpensive air mattress in a twin size. This way you'll have it for the next trip! Have a great trip!
 

You'll have to bring sheets for the air mattress as well as the resort will not provide them.
 
I just bring a pee pad and a shower curtain to put under DSs side of the bed 'just in case'....

If you decide to go the air mattress route, many have fabricy feeling tops so you will want to make sure you have somethign to protect it from wetness/smell anyway.
